Medical gloves are a critical consumable in a multi-billion dollar global market. Their production is concentrated in manufacturing hubs with access to raw materials (like latex and petrochemicals) and cost-effective, large-scale production capabilities. The companies that make medical gloves range from massive publicly traded conglomerates producing billions of gloves annually to smaller, specialized firms focusing on niche markets like chemotherapy-rated or sustainable gloves. For healthcare procurement, understanding this manufacturer landscape is key to ensuring supply chain resilience, quality, and value.
Manufacturers can be broadly categorized by their scale, focus, and role in the supply chain.
These are industrial powerhouses, often based in Asia, with vertically integrated operations from raw material sourcing to final packaging. They produce on a colossal scale for the global market.
- Top Glove Corporation Bhd (Malaysia): Frequently cited as the world's largest manufacturer of medical gloves, producing both natural rubber latex and nitrile gloves. They supply major distributors and brands worldwide.
- Hartalega Holdings Berhad (Malaysia): A leader in advanced synthetic nitrile glove technology, known for innovation in production efficiency and product quality.
- Kossan Rubber Industries Bhd (Malaysia): Another Malaysian giant with significant production capacity across latex and nitrile examination and surgical gloves.
- Supermax Corporation Berhad (Malaysia): A major global player with a wide portfolio of medical gloves.
- Ansell Limited (Global, HQ in Australia/US): While a manufacturer, Ansell is also a premier global *brand*. They operate manufacturing plants and produce a wide range of specialized gloves, including surgical, chemotherapy, and industrial.
These companies focus on specific segments of the market, often with higher value-added products.
- Cardinal Health (USA): A leading healthcare services and products company. While primarily a distributor, Cardinal Health also manufactures its own line of medical gloves, including surgical and exam gloves, under its branded portfolio.
- Medline Industries, Inc. (USA): Another major distributor and manufacturer, producing a vast array of medical gloves and other PPE for the healthcare market.
- Semperit AG (Austria): A European manufacturer with a long history, specializing in high-quality surgical and examination gloves.
- Companies focusing on Sustainable/Biodegradable Gloves: A growing segment includes manufacturers developing medical gloves from alternative materials like polylactic acid (PLA) or with recycled content, catering to environmentally conscious healthcare systems.

Regardless of size, reputable medical glove manufacturers adhere to a similar core process:
1. Compounding: Mixing the base polymer (latex, nitrile compound, or PVC plastisol) with curatives, accelerators, and other chemicals.
2. Former Dipping: Ceramic or aluminum hand-shaped formers are cleaned and dipped into the compound.
3. Coagulation & Gelling: For latex/nitrile, a coagulant causes the material to gel on the former. For vinyl, heat fuses the plastisol.
4. Leaching & Beading: (Latex/Nitrile) Soluble chemicals are washed out; the cuff may be rolled.
5. Vulcanization/Curing: The gloves are cured in ovens to cross-link polymers and achieve final strength.
6. Stripping, Testing, and Packaging: Gloves are stripped from formers, undergo 100% visual inspection and sample-based testing (for AQL, pinholes, dimensions), and are packaged.
Quality is governed by international standards (ASTM, ISO) and regulatory oversight (FDA, CE). Leading manufacturers invest heavily in automated production lines and rigorous quality control laboratories.
Few hospitals buy directly from Top Glove or Hartalega. The supply chain typically flows:
Manufacturer → Global Distributor/Brand Owner (e.g., Ansell, Cardinal Health) → Regional Medical Supplier (e.g., McKesson, Henry Schein) → Hospital/Clinic.

For procurement specialists or OEM partners, evaluating a medical glove manufacturer involves:
- Certifications: FDA registration/clearance, CE Mark, ISO 13485 quality management.
- Product Range & Specialization: Does they make the types needed (nitrile exam, sterile surgical, chemo-rated)?
- Production Capacity & Reliability: Can they meet volume demands consistently?
- Quality Track Record: History of recalls or regulatory actions?
- Cost Structure & MOQs: Pricing and minimum order quantities.
- Sustainability Initiatives: Efforts in reducing environmental impact.

The title of world's largest manufacturer is typically held by Top Glove Corporation Bhd, based in Malaysia. They operate numerous factories with a massive production capacity, manufacturing billions of both natural rubber latex and synthetic nitrile medical gloves annually for the global market. Other Malaysian giants like Hartalega and Kossan are also among the top global producers.
Companies like Medline Industries and Cardinal Health are both manufacturers and distributors. They operate their own manufacturing facilities for certain lines of medical gloves (often under their own brand names), while also distributing gloves produced by other large manufacturers like Top Glove or Hartalega. This hybrid model gives them control over quality for key products and breadth of supply.

While the majority of volume production is in Asia, there are significant manufacturers in the US and Europe, often focusing on higher-value, specialized segments. Ansell (headquartered in Australia but with global operations, including in the US) is a major player. Semperit in Austria is a well-known European manufacturer. Cardinal Health and Medline have US-based manufacturing for some lines. These companies often compete on quality, innovation, and supply chain security rather than lowest cost.
